Here’s the last set of results of 2015 on the local bowls scene

written by Alan Foley December 20, 2015
FacebookTweetLinkedInEmailPrint

Below are results from Cup and League matches played before the Christmas Break.


Knockout Cup:-
Manor 63  Cathedral 48.
Killea 55  Clonleigh 30

Jimmy Harte Cup:-
St Johnston Pres. 53  Donoughmore 26
Ramelton Pres 36  Milford Academy “A” 60.

Section One League:-
Cathedral 6  Ramelton 6.
Ramelton Pres. 8  St Eunan’s “B”4.
Milford Academy “A” 6  Donoughmore 6.
